Photo by 20th Century Fox/Kobal Collection, WireImageEmpire Magazine recently put out their list of "The 100 Greatest Movie Characters," placing Tyler Durden from "Fight Club" at number one. Here's a slideshow of 25 other great characters we feel their list left out.
